The Exact Conversion Formula
The universal relationship between feet and centimeters is based on the definition that 1 inch equals 2.54 centimeters and 1 foot equals 12 inches. By chaining these two facts together, the conversion becomes straightforward:
[ \text{Centimeters} = \text{Feet} \times 12 \times 2.54 ]
Applying the formula to 2 feet:
[ 2 \text{ ft} \times 12 = 24 \text{ inches} ]
[ 24 \text{ in} \times 2.54 \text{ cm/in} = 60.96 \text{ cm} ]

Step‑by‑Step Conversion Guide
If you prefer a manual approach without a calculator, follow these easy steps:
- Multiply the number of feet by 12 to get the total inches.
- Example: 2 ft × 12 = 24 in.
- Multiply the resulting inches by 2.54 (the exact centimeter value of an inch).
- Example: 24 in × 2.54 = 60.96 cm.

Frequently Asked Questions (FAQ)
Q1: Is 2 feet always exactly 60.96 cm, or does temperature affect it?
A: The conversion is based on defined constants (1 in = 2.54 cm). Temperature does not change the numerical relationship, though physical materials may expand or contract slightly with temperature changes.
Q2: Why do some sources round 2 ft to 61 cm?
A: Rounding to the nearest whole centimeter (61 cm) simplifies communication, especially in casual contexts where sub‑millimeter precision isn’t required.
Q3: How do I convert 2 feet 3 inches to centimeters?
A: First convert the whole feet: 2 ft = 60.96 cm. Then convert the inches: 3 in × 2.54 = 7.62 cm. Add them together: 60.96 + 7.62 = 68.58 cm.
Q4: Can I use the conversion for 2 feet in a different metric unit, like meters?
A: Yes. Since 1 meter = 100 cm, divide the centimeter value by 100. For 2 ft: 60.96 cm ÷ 100 = 0.6096 meters.

Common Mistakes to Avoid
- Forgetting the 12‑inch factor – Jumping straight from feet to centimeters without converting to inches first leads to a 12‑fold error.
- Using 2.5 cm per inch – Some approximate 1 in = 2.5 cm; this yields 2 ft = 60 cm, which is close but not precise.

- Rounding too early – If you round intermediate steps, the final answer can drift further from the exact 60.96 cm. Keep full precision until the last step, then round if needed.
